Update: More kidnapping & robbery charges

Chatham-Kent Police Service officials allege: On December 10 around 1:30 a.m. police responded to a single motor vehicle collision on Park Avenue West near Bloomfield Road.

Through investigation, police learned that the driver was forced into his vehicle and threatened with a weapon after an altercation at a residence in Chatham.

After the crash, the man in the car stole the driver’s wallet and cell phone and was picked up by a trio who was following them.

Police have identified all four people responsible.

A 24-year-old woman and 30-year-old man, both of Chatham, have been previously arrested and charged with robbery and kidnapping.

Officers located the other two parties last night a 29-year old male and a 22-year old female both of Chatham have been arrested and charged with robbery and kidnapping

They were transported to Chatham-Kent Court House for a bail hearing.
